ASP架构全攻略:技术解析与安全实战
|
在当前的网络安全环境中,ASP(Active Server Pages)架构虽然已经逐渐被更现代的技术所取代,但其仍然在许多遗留系统中扮演着重要角色。作为蓝队防御工程师,我们不能忽视这些系统的潜在风险。 ASP架构依赖于服务器端的脚本语言,如VBScript或JScript来生成动态网页内容。这种设计使得攻击者可以通过注入恶意代码来操控应用行为,例如SQL注入、跨站脚本(XSS)或文件包含漏洞。 为了有效防御,我们需要对ASP应用进行严格的输入验证和输出编码。任何用户输入都应被视为不可信,必须经过过滤和转义处理,以防止恶意代码的执行。 同时,合理配置服务器权限和目录访问控制也是关键。避免将敏感信息存储在可公开访问的路径下,确保日志文件和配置文件的安全性,防止攻击者通过路径遍历获取敏感数据。 定期进行代码审计和漏洞扫描同样不可或缺。利用自动化工具和手动检查相结合的方式,识别潜在的安全隐患,并及时修复。
插画AI辅助完成,仅供参考 在实战中,我们还需要关注ASP应用与后端数据库的交互方式。使用参数化查询可以有效防止SQL注入攻击,而限制数据库用户的权限则能减少潜在的破坏范围。 建立完善的日志记录和监控机制,有助于快速发现异常行为并采取响应措施。日志分析可以揭示攻击者的痕迹,为后续的溯源和防御提供依据。 站长个人见解,尽管ASP架构已不再主流,但在实际工作中仍需保持警惕。通过技术解析与安全实战的结合,我们可以有效提升系统的防御能力,降低被攻击的风险。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330470号